Your question: How can I speed up Photoshop?

You can improve performance by increasing the amount of memory/RAM allocated to Photoshop. The Memory Usage area of the Performance preferences dialog (Preferences > Performance) tells you how much RAM is available to Photoshop. It also shows the ideal Photoshop memory allocation range for your system.

Why is Photoshop using so much memory?

A scratch disk is a hard disk drive or SSD used for temporary storage while Photoshop is running. Photoshop uses this space to store portions of your documents and their history panel states that don’t fit in the memory or RAM of your machine.

Does Photoshop slow down your computer?

Using the clipboard is a very useful function inside Photoshop, however, it will slow down your computer if you’re not careful. The photos are held temporarily in Photoshop’s allocated RAM, which will make the rest of the software run slower.

Do I need 32gb of RAM for Photoshop?

Photoshop is mainly bandwidth limited – moving data in and out of memory. But there is never “enough” RAM no matter how much you have installed. More memory is always needed. … A scratch file is always set up, and whatever RAM you have acts as a fast access cache to the scratch disk’s main memory.
